Understanding D&D Dice: A Beginner's Guide

Getting started with D&D can feel daunting , especially when it comes to understanding the polyhedral dice . Don't panic! This basic guide will cover the different types of polyhedrons you'll see in your games. You'll find common dice denoted by letters , like d4 (a four-sided die), d6 (the classic six-sided cube), d8 (an octagonal die), d10 (often used in combinations for percentage rolls), d12 (a dodecahedron die), and the d20 (the key die for many actions). A Tale of D&D's Cubes : From Shapes to Unusual

The beginning of D&D dice is quite connected in traditional gaming practices. Initially, a lot of games employed simple six-sided dice, but the rise of D&D's & Dragons's game spurred a requirement for a wider range of multi-sided shapes. First versions of the system utilized custom-made dice, often requiring players to meticulously manufacture their own. As acceptance increased , companies began supplying these unique dice, leading to the familiar set of four-sided, six-sided, eight-sided, ten-sided, twelve-sided and d20s we understand today. Today's dice creation has also seen a rise in unusual designs and materials , ranging from shiny dice to those including special imagery.

Caring about D&D Dice:Dice -Dice & Durability Advice

To maximize the longevity of your precious dice, basic attention is vital. Refrain from flinging them recklessly across the table; instead, carefully cast them. Regularly dust your collection with a clean towel to eliminate dirt and fingerprints. Keeping them in a dice bag when not in use protects abrasions.
